This episode of I.S.N TV hosted by Charles Griffin features Diamond Divas head coach Sean Tucker.
Ā Sean speaks on the success of his dance company, upcoming auditions, competitions and how much of a humbling experience it was to being voted by his community to attend the NAACP Awards as a āHometown Heroā.

This episodes of I.S.N TV features Charles Griffin runway coaching for loctician Preston Clark of Escape Salon and Day Spa preparing for Studio 54 Hairshow.
Take a look as Charles show models how to walk, be fierce and also sits down with Preston for a 1 on 1 interview.
